1936 Ford Deluxe three-window coupe. This all steel car (no
fiberglass), features a rumble seat and is powered by a traditional
flathead V8 engine paired with a 3-speed manual transmission
shifted on the floor. Great looking chrome and brightwork,
including the distinctive grille, chrome artillery-style wheels
with wide whitewall bias ply tires, and fender skirts that
elegantly conceal the rear wheels. The paint has a glossy finish
with a few small imperfections typical of a car driven and enjoyed.
The interior is in great condition with a tan cloth bench seat,
matching door panels, and original style push-button floor starter.
Recent service work includes a new carburetor and newer dual
exhaust system that is straight-piped with side exits. Speedometer,
amps and oil pressure gauges reading. The gas gauge reads but
operates inversely (full shows empty and vice versa). There is some
slack in the steering. The exhaust has that great throaty flathead
sound characteristic of the era. On the road the car's smooth
shifting, solid clutch feel, and flat cornering are evident.
